Hi,
I have the following problem:
$ echo -e '\x0' > a
$ git diff --no-index --binary /dev/null a > patch
$ rm a
$ git apply patch
fatal: git diff header lacks filename information (line 4)
$ cat patch
GIT binary patch
literal 2
JcmZSJ0ssIE01E&B
literal 0
HcmV?d00001

Hmm. The problem is that "git apply" doesn't accept that "a/dev/null"
and "b/a" are the same, so it rejects them as a name. I guess on a text
patch, we would just pull that information from the "---" and "+++"
lines, so we don't care that it's not on the diff commandline.
However, a _non_ --no-index patch doesn't produce the same output. It
will actually produce the line:
diff --git a/a b/a
even if it is a creation patch. So I'm not sure which piece of code is
at fault. Either:
1. git apply is right to reject, and "git diff --no-index" should be
putting the actual filename on the commandline of a binary patch
instead of /dev/null, even if it is a creation patch.
or
2. git apply should accept this construct. Perhaps we should relax the
"both names must be the same" rule if one of the names is /dev/null
(and we would take the other)?

Exactly. In order to avoid all the ambiguities, we want the filename to
match on the 'diff -' line to even be able to guess, and if it doesn't, we
should pick it up from the "rename from" lines (for a git diff), or from
the '--- a/filename'/'+++ b/filename' otherwise (if it's not a rename, or
not a git diff).
And being a binary diff, and a creation event, all of this fails.
To make things worse, git has also screwed up the "/dev/null" and
prepended the prefix to it, making it even harder to see any patterns to
the names. Gaah.
However, a _non_ --no-index patch doesn't produce the same output. It
will actually produce the line:
diff --git a/a b/a
even if it is a creation patch. So I'm not sure which piece of code is
at fault.
It's some of both. I think --no-index is broken, that "a/dev/null" is
total crap regardless of anything else. There's no way that thing is
correct, and even if you were not to want "a/a", it should have been just
plain "/dev/null".
But for a native git patch, we shouldn't even use the (at least slightly
more correct) "/dev/null", since native git application doesn't actually
do the "is_dev_null()" for native patches, and just wants the filename to
be the same.
So I think "git apply" is correct, and "git diff --no-index" is broken.
That said, I think git-apply being "correct" is not a great excuse, and we
should do the "be liberal in what you accept, conservative in what you
generate", and think about how to make git-apply be more willing to handle
this case too.
Quite frankly, I should have doen the explicit headers as
"new file " <mode> SP <name>
instead of
"new file mode " <mode>
(and same for "deleted file", obviously) and the patch would have been
more readable _and_ we'd have avoided this issue. But when I did all that,
I didn't even think of binary diffs (they weren't an issue originally).
Dang.
Anyway, for now I'd suggest a patch like this. Hmm? The "diff --git"
format assumes that the names are the same, so make it so.

Ok, so here's a much better version, I think.
It just refuses to use an invalid name for anything visible in the diff.
Now, this fixes the "git diff --no-index --binary a /dev/null" kind of
case (and we'll end up using "a" as the basename), but some other insane
cases are impossible to handle. If you do
git diff --no-index --binary a /bin/echo
you'll still get a patch like
diff --git a/a b/bin/echo
old mode 100644
new mode 100755
index ...
and "git apply" will refuse to apply it for a couple of reasons, and the
diff is simply bogus.
And that, btw, is no longer a bug, I think. It's impossible to know whethe
the user meant for the patch to be a rename or not. And as such, refusing
to apply it because you don't know what name you should use is probably
_exactly_ the right thing to do!

Ah, I found it. It was the fact that _text_ diffs using --no-index also
generate that bogosity. But of course they work fine, since we just
reject the "default" name from the "diff --git" line, but end up getting
the names from the "---" and "+++" lines.
